How these numbers were worked out

A hit here: 1,000+ reviews, roughly $150k+ before Steam's cut (a standard indie benchmark).

Copies come from each game's reviews times a sales-per-review rate that falls with release age, from about 31 for the most recent game here to about 43 for the oldest, then widened into a range; revenue rides on that estimate times price. Source: GameDiscoverCo (2020) and VG Insights (2021).
